Selecting a Military Storage Unit to Your Orders

Guessing on size is the most common (and most expensive) mistake. As a rough starting point:

Storage Unit Size
Roughly Equivalent To
What It Fits
5x5

A large hall closet

Uniforms, records, boxes from a single barracks room

5x10

A walk-in closet

One person's belongings during an unaccompanied tour

10x10

A studio apartment

Bedroom furniture, appliances, and boxes of household goods

10x15

A one-bedroom apartment

A couple's furniture during a temporary relocation

10x20

A two-car garage

A full household's furniture during a PCS

10x25 and 10x30

A three-bedroom home

A large HHG shipment, or household goods, plus a vehicle

Actual dimensions vary by facility. Run your specific inventory past Storage Star's size guide before you commit to a size.

Military Storage Features You Need

Most storage features sound the same on paper. Here's what you should be on the lookout for when searching for a military storage unit near you:

Secure storage features, including 24/7 recorded video, gated entry, and lighting after dark

Climate-controlled units for temperature-sensitive items, including electronics, wood, and paper

Drive-up access for easy loading and unloading

Month-to-month leases that can be easily canceled

An online account portal that can be accessed in any time zone

Local staff on-site who can answer your move-in questions

Packing supplies sold on-site so you don't have to make an extra trip for boxes or tape

A military discount

Frequently Asked Questions About Military Storage

How long can I rent a military storage unit at Storage Star?

Storage Star rents by the month with no fixed-term lease, so you keep the unit exactly as long as your orders require and give notice whenever you're ready to close the account.

Can I rent a storage unit for a short training or TDY assignment?

Yes! Month-to-month billing means a unit rented for a single training cycle or temporary duty assignment costs the same per month as one kept for a year, with no minimum term.

Can I store a personal vehicle while I'm deployed?

Many Storage Star locations have vehicle parking for cars, motorcycles, and trailers during deployment. Large drive-up storage units are also a great option for indoor vehicle storage.

Does Storage Star offer a military discount?

Yes. Storage Star offers a 10% military discount. Contact your local Storage Star facility for eligibility requirements and additional information.

Can I pay for and manage my unit from overseas?

Storage Star's online account portal works from any country with internet access, letting you pay, enroll in autopay, or update your unit remotely without calling in during odd time zones.
